Transaction 12605c458571dc19c35ebf4ee7cf5d496813dae5d43e329c37ed52dfebb9a03a
1 Input
1 Output
-
12605c458571dc19c35ebf4ee7cf5d496813dae5d43e329c37ed52dfebb9a03a:0
- value
- 11918129
- script pubkey
- OP_0 OP_PUSHBYTES_20 0a903d53d6b2e93db14470f37d29b621bb958fb2
- address
- bc1qp2gr657kkt5nmv2ywreh62dkyxaetrajh3kxr2